High School Softball Roundup: Brockway Falls to Johnsonburg

Tuesday’s high school softball recaps.

JOHNSONBURG 9, BROCKWAY 0

BROCKWAY, Pa. – Hannah Park threw a no-hitter to lead Johnsonburg to a 9-0 win at Brockway.

Park walked three and struck out four.

Nicole Myers, Britnee Thorwart and Ashton Watts each drove in two runs for the Ramettes with Myers going 2-for-4 with two runs scored, Thorwart going 2-for-4 and Watts going 1-for-4 with a double.

Also for Johnsonburg, Alyssa Kasmierski was 3-for-4 with a run scored and an RBI.

Kayla Dowdall took the loss giving up the nine runs, but only one of them was earned. She gave up 10 hits and a walk while striking out four.

CLARION-LIMESTONE 9, KEYSTONE 8, 8 INNINGS

KNOX, Pa. – Megan Schimp scored on a wild pitch in the top of the eighth inning to give Clarion-Limestone a 9-8 win at Keystone.

Schimp started the eight with a walk, stole second and moved to third on a single by Sadie Mahle.

The Lady Lions trailed 8-3 going to the seventh but scored five times in the inning on four hits and three Keystone errors to tie the game at eight and force extra innings.

Mahle had a double in the inning and Abby Carl, Paige Aaron, Alyssa Kiser all had singles.

Mahle finished with three hits, Schimp had two hits and two runs, Kiser had two hits and Carl and Aaron each scored two runs.

Rebecca Hurst had a pair of hits for Keystone, as did McKenna Stiller, who had a double.

KARNS CITY 16, FOREST AREA 4, 5 INNINGS

CHICORA, Pa. – Ashley Coon and Alyssa Stitt each had three hits to lead Karns City to a 16-4, five-inning win over visiting Forest Area.

Coon tripled, doubled and singled, while Stitt had a triple and two singles. Makala Bailey added an inside-the-park home run for the Lady Gremlins.

LeeAnn Gibson got the win striking out four.

Sarah Schettler led the Lady Fires with a pair of hits.
